Guy Rizzo is a financial advisor with Wells Fargo Advisors, holding Series 63 and Series 65 credentials and bringing 31 years of industry experience. He has been with Wells Fargo Advisors Financial Network LLC since 2009. Outside of his advisory role, he serves as president and board member of the Mariner Square Condominium Association and is a notary public in Rhode Island. Wells Fargo Advisors Financial Network is a large broker-dealer and registered investment adviser affiliated with Wells Fargo, providing investment and fee-based financial planning services to individuals, trusts, and institutional clients. The firm offers a broad range of planning services and integrates advisory offerings with other financial products and referral channels.

Fee options

Commissions

Brokerage commissions are charged if clients implement investment recommendations through Wells Fargo Advisors brokerage accounts, in addition to advisory fees.

Other

Account minimum: $250,000 Fee-only: Fee-Based Planning Services fees range from $0 up to $25,000 per engagement, varying by service complexity and client's net worth. Specific fees are as follows: For clients with a net worth $250,000 to $500,000, total fee per engagement up to $5,000; $500,000 to $1,000,000, up to $12,500; over $1,000,000, up to $25,000. Individual service fees range up to $1,000-$1,500 to $5,000-$7,500 depending on net worth and service type.
